Croploo is an all-in-one AI-powered grain market terminal designed specifically for traders specializing in corn, wheat, and soy. It consolidates critical market data such as basis levels, USDA reports, COT positioning, weather forecasts, and freight rates into a single, user-friendly platform. Unlike traditional methods that require juggling multiple tabs and sources, Croploo offers a streamlined experience with live elevator bids, detailed WASDE analysis, and an integrated CullyAI chat analyst that provides real-time insights. Automatic alerts notify users of basis anomalies and USDA report releases, enabling traders to respond swiftly to market developments. Its cross-platform compatibility on Mac, Windows, and Linux makes it accessible for diverse trading desks. By integrating key data streams and AI-driven analysis, Croploo empowers grain traders with enhanced decision-making capabilities, saving time and reducing manual effort while improving trading precision.

OpenClaw is an innovative AI-powered personal agent that transforms your computer into a 24/7 automation hub, accessible from popular chat platforms like WhatsApp and Telegram. Building on its predecessors Moltbot and Clawbot, OpenClaw offers extensive control over your system, enabling users to execute shell commands, manage files, control browsers, and automate workflows seamlessly. Its persistent memory and full system access make it a powerful tool for developers, tech enthusiasts, and productivity-focused individuals seeking a highly customizable automation experience. What sets OpenClaw apart is its open-source foundation, over 50 integrations, and emphasis on privacy by operating locally on your machine, ensuring sensitive data remains secure. Its versatility and ease of access make it an attractive solution for those looking to enhance productivity, streamline repetitive tasks, or build complex automation pipelines using familiar chat interfaces.
